Italy and Germany showed slight declines, with Italy down by 3.82% and Germany by 0.25% in 2023. The United Kingdom also exhibited a small decline of 1.87%, while France showed minor positive growth at 0.24%. Estonia remained stable with no changes.
The European market for machines for balancing mechanical parts may experience growth with increasing industrial automation and maintenance needs. Monitoring technological advancements and regional investments will be critical in predicting future market dynamics.
